
Organizando o festival de TI do TechTrain, nós mesmos não entendemos completamente o que seria. É claro que sabíamos sobre o que seriam os relatórios e quais seriam as posições. Porém, quando você reúne 2000 pessoas de TI com um histórico completamente diferente para um evento completamente novo, pode obter algumas respostas apenas na prática. O que o público mais gostará? Qual será o principal problema? As pessoas que escrevem código em diferentes idiomas encontrarão um idioma comum?
Agora, uma semana se passou com o TechTrain. Durante esse período, coletamos comentários e carregamos
fotos , para que possamos resumir.

É difícil escrever sobre um evento, onde a cada momento muitas coisas acontecem ao mesmo tempo. Enquanto alguns espectadores ouvem os relatórios, outros descobrem algo sobre o PiterPy de
Dmitry nazarov_tech Nazarov , outros aguardam os resultados da competição da empresa de TI, outros estão cortando o Prince of Persia usando computadores retrô e assim por diante. E, no final, onde quer que você esteja, você vê apenas uma pequena parte do que está acontecendo, e neste texto muitas coisas interessantes podem ser perdidas. Se você já esteve no TechTrain, sinta-se à vontade para adicionar comentários!
Normalmente, realizamos conferências para desenvolvedores (do Joker ao HolyJS) e, em comparação com eles, foi exatamente essa diversidade que chamou minha atenção. Nas conferências durante os relatórios, o salão está quase completamente vazio: todos estão adquirindo conhecimento em sua principal especialidade. Aqui, os relatórios também foram importantes, mas ainda assim muitos espectadores permaneceram no lobby.
O que exatamente era uma alternativa aos relatórios? Por exemplo, stands de comunidades de TI - isso não ocorre em nossas conferências habituais. Em algumas dessas bancas, você pode descobrir “quem você é e o que está fazendo” e, em algum lugar, foi além e iniciou uma jogada interessante: o PiterJS organizou um concurso “Code in the Dark” com layout cego, e o podcast Podlodka fez uma mini entrevista de participantes do festival, de
Oleg olegbunin Bunin ao diretor profissional do Postgres,
Oleg Bartunov .

Além dos estandes, as comunidades também tinham uma “zona de demonstração”: sua própria plataforma pequena para mini-apresentações de 15 minutos. Era possível não ir ao salão para uma reportagem “grande”, mas ficar sentado por um tempo, ouvindo algo bem no salão e continuar.
Enquanto as comunidades de TI estavam localizadas em um lado do salão, o oposto era ocupado pelas empresas de TI. Eles tinham sua própria zona de demonstração, usada para apresentações semelhantes de 15 minutos e para resumir os resultados das competições. E lá, entre os mini-relatórios, havia um líder claro. A história de
Pavel Yurkin, de Leroy Merlin, sobre seu projeto de estimação - um programa para compor músicas em tempo real “sob o Bach” - atraiu muitas pessoas e terminou com aplausos. Aqui, o formato da apresentação coincidiu bem com o formato do local: se eles foram para os relatórios "grandes" de propósito, eles se voltaram para os "pequenos", com o princípio de "passear e se interessar", e quando Pavel lançou peças de música pelos alto-falantes, atraiu a atenção.
Obviamente, além da zona de demonstração, as empresas tinham estandes. Isso pode ser visto em conferências, mas havia muitas e muito diferentes: da Kontur, famosa por seus serviços de negócios, à entrega saudável de alimentos, GrowFood, da gigante americana Dell EMC e à Russian JetBrains.

Além disso, eles jogavam jogos de tabuleiro do Mosigra no saguão, participavam do questionário Brain Slaughter, comiam ... Então, aqui chegamos a um momento doloroso. Os espectadores do TechTrain classificaram por unanimidade a comida como o principal problema: eles dizem, e as filas são longas e sem gosto. Havia espectadores que gostaram de tudo, mas, em geral, o problema é óbvio, nós percebemos e levaremos essa experiência em consideração.
Bem, você pode pelo menos ficar contente que a principal desvantagem do evento esteja relacionada à comida, e não ao que as pessoas procuraram - como relatórios.

Vamos passar de alimento em alimento para a mente: sobre o que eram os relatórios? No caso do TechTrain, nós mesmos precisamos pensar cuidadosamente sobre esse problema com antecedência. Passando muitos anos de uma conferência para programadores, entendemos quais problemas preocupam os doadores e quais desenvolvedores móveis. Mas o que dizer no evento, onde serão os dois? Que nível de treinamento do público é esperado quando os espectadores têm diferentes origens? Como garantir que um não seja claro demais e o outro incompreensível?
O resultado são duas opções diferentes. Alguns relatórios foram projetados para um segmento específico da audiência: o tema “O lugar da vibração na vida de um desenvolvedor Android” dificilmente atraiu muitas pessoas que não são relacionadas ao Android. E embora
alguém possa participar de uma sessão de perguntas sobre blitz sobre Kotlin com
Andrei Breslav , não surpreende que os kotlinistas tenham chegado lá com perguntas específicas como "o operador ternário aparecerá". (Acabou por aparecer!)

Mas a maioria das performances foi projetada para todos de uma vez.
Roman Nevolin comparou diferentes paradigmas de programação - e para seguir seu pensamento, você não precisava ter experiência pessoal com cada um.
Ilya Klimov falou sobre JavaScript "para aqueles que não estão lá" - ou seja, seu relatório foi adequado para todos, exceto os próprios javascripts.
Denis Mishunov chegou a ter um relatório como “como viver quando você não quer enlouquecer na corrida pela tecnologia” - e essa pergunta é relevante para todos, exceto aqueles que trabalham com a COBOL.
Uma história separada é o “Interrogatório de Inteligência” de
Dmitry “Goblin” Puchkov e
Ivan Yamshchikov . O duende, é claro, é a figura mais controversa do festival: mesmo antes do início do evento, alguns espectadores ficaram muito satisfeitos com sua participação, enquanto outros ficaram muito infelizes. Ao mesmo tempo, o aprendizado de máquina, no qual Ivan está envolvido, não é o que Dmitry se especializa. E como foi a entrevista? Cabe ao público decidir, e eles ficaram encantados: nas resenhas, escrevem que, graças a ambos os interlocutores, ficou animada, inteligível, informativa e divertida.

A menos que o tempo de 45 minutos seja considerado insuficiente para uma conversa tão interessante. Mas o sentimento "muito curto" pode ser parcialmente corrigido na área de discussão. Como em nossas conferências, cada orador após o discurso respondeu às perguntas do público em um local especialmente designado onde eles poderiam se comunicar como deveriam - e muitos oradores estavam corretamente cercados por lá.

Os relatórios em vídeo dos relatórios aparecerão em domínio público mais tarde, mas por enquanto os enviamos aos espectadores que preencheram o formulário de feedback. É longo e, para alguns, era censurável. Mas sem uma boa razão, não faríamos isso: afinal, de uma forma longa, estamos aumentando o trabalho não apenas para o público, mas também para nós mesmos!
Qual o motivo? O fato de que, sem um feedback detalhado, não é óbvio como melhorar o público no futuro. Por exemplo, como você sabe quais relatórios você mais gostou? A julgar por sinais indiretos, como a revitalização no salão, apenas os "mais alegres" serão os "melhores", enquanto os mais atenciosos certamente perderão. Mas, com o feedback, tudo fica muito mais claro: obtemos uma classificação média para cada relatório e eles podem ser comparados.
Portanto, graças aos espectadores classificados, compilamos uma lista dos melhores relatórios do TechTrain. Se você participou do festival e recebeu gravações de vídeo, pode decidir o que assistir primeiro. Aqui estão os três líderes:
- Vitaliy Fridman com o tópico "Padrões de design de interfaces responsivas inteligentes" . Vitaly, conhecido como o criador da Smashing Magazine, no ano passado se apaixonou pelo público da nossa conferência HolyJS. Mas era óbvio que não apenas os desenvolvedores de JS puderam gostar de seus discursos brilhantes sobre interfaces, e o primeiro lugar, segundo os espectadores do TechTrain, confirmou isso.

- Dmitry Zavalishin - Práticas e casos de gerenciamento de projetos . Por nome, você pode pensar que o relatório é relevante apenas para os gerentes. Mas, na verdade, ele pode ser de interesse para quem pensa não apenas em código, mas também em como esse código surge em equipes reais em projetos reais. Todos enfrentamos processos, o livro Mythical Man-Month é até certo ponto relevante para todos nós - e também para este relatório.

- Evgeny Borisov - Mitos sobre o Spark ou Can Spark é um desenvolvedor Java regular . E aqui está um exemplo de um "relatório para um público específico", já nomeado para o mundo orientado à JVM. Considerando que a Evgeny tem uma autoridade gigantesca entre os javistas por um longo tempo, uma alta classificação neste caso dificilmente surpreendeu ninguém.

O restante dos 10 primeiros está simplesmente listado:
- Complicando o jogo (Sergey Abdulmanov, Mosigra)
- depurador para desenvolvedores (Denis Mishunov, consultor independente)
- Transparência total na empresa (Mikhail Samarin, Futurice)
- Como os dados são transformados em conhecimento e por que ser capaz de sonhar é uma das habilidades mais importantes (Ivan Yamshchikov, ABBYY)
- Informações com Ivan Yamshchikov (Dmitry Puchkov, Oper.ru)
- Sessão de perguntas do Blitz (Andrey Breslav, JetBrains)
- A evolução dos paradigmas (Roman Nevolin, Careem)
Após o relatório de Vitaly Fridman, o festival foi oficialmente encerrado, mas para alguns participantes não terminou aí: Dmitry Nazarov convidou todos para uma festa nas proximidades em uma festa improvisada e, no bate-papo com o TechTrain Telegram, descobrimos que os participantes que vieram de Petrozavodsk já querem Chegando em casa para fazer as malas novamente. E suponho que nós mesmos não conhecemos todas essas atividades, então é melhor você nos contar sobre elas!